Started creating a list of things I find annoying about Mac. I am sure over time Apple will address or improve some of these but is really a pain coming from a Windows user.
- Create new file on Finder in the folder you are in. Right click on a folder in Windows explorer will allow me to create a new file in the folder I am in. For OSX I had to create an Apple script to do this simple task
- Excel for Windows allows me to import portions of a Web page using Web queries. This can be done directly in the Excel app. For OSX this functionality is not available and broken.
- Drag and drop an email from Outlook Mac results in a html code .eml file instead of a properly formatted email that you can read later
- Dock window to right or left of screen using the keyboard
- Editing a cell in Excel. Pressing F2 allows me to edit the cell. In Mac I have to use a mouse
- Windows handles multiple windows of a same app so efficiently. I can switch between windows easily using alt tab
- Locking screen. Have to use mouse to click some icon to lock. Windows Control L works
- Copy paste file into an email example outlook. Mac pastes the location of file rather than the file
- Apple doesn't offer a Cut and Paste option for moving files in Finder (although you can Copy and Paste)
- Finder cannot sort folders first
- Microsoft Outlook is horrible on Mac. There are so many things I can do easily on Outlook on Windows. To do the same steps on Mac, it takes 3 times the effort
- Try duplicating a meeting (not an appointment, a meeting)
- Try creating a meeting and selecting attendees as optional. You have to mark them individually.
- Try cutting a file and pasting at a different location. Command + X and Command + V dont work for this. There are different keys to do this.
